The Uses of 6-Chloropurine riboside
6-Chloropurine riboside is used to study the kinetics and substrate specificity of adenosine deaminase. 6-Chloropurine riboside is benzoylated to facilitate synthesis of nucleoside derivatives such as 9-(2,3-Di-deoxy-2-fluoro-β-D-threo-pentofuranosyl)adenine. It , especially after phosphorylation to NMP, NDP or NTP, is used as a purine substrate analogue in studies with enzymes such as Inosine monophosphate dehydrogenase (IMPDH); bacteriophage T4 RNA-ligase (EC 6.5.1.3) and pancreatic fibonuclease A.

Properties of 6-Chloropurine riboside
| Melting point: | 158-162 °C (dec.) (lit.) |
| Boiling point: | 614.8±65.0 °C(Predicted) |
| Density | 2.03±0.1 g/cm3(Predicted) |
| storage temp. | -20°C |
| solubility | DMSO (Sparingly, Heated), Methanol (Slightly, Heated), Water (Slightly, Heated, |
| form | Powder |
| pka | 13.06±0.70(Predicted) |
| color | White to slightly yellow |
| Water Solubility | Soluble in water. (10.6 mg/mL) |
